Data recovery using a cloud-based remote data recovery center
First Claim
1. A computer program product comprising a non-transitory computer-readable media having code stored thereon, the code when executed by a processor, causing the processor to assist in providing a cloud-based backup storage service to a computer network at a cloud-based backup storage facility, the method comprising:
- configuring, at the cloud-based backup storage facility, a cloud storage manager to communicatively couple to a local storage manager,wherein the cloud storage manager is at a geographical location that is remote from a geographical location of the local storage manager,wherein the computer network includes the local storage manager but not the cloud storage manager;
wherein the local storage manager is configured to control a backup operation of data in the computer network and communicate storage metadata generated during the backup operation to the cloud storage manager,wherein the storage metadata includes metadata pointers, lookup tables, or any combination thereof,wherein the storage metadata is used during restoration of actual data backed up during the backup operation into usable data, andwherein the storage metadata is generated during the backup operation of data in the computer network;
receiving, without receiving the actual data backed up during the backup operation, the storage metadata at the cloud storage manager;
processing, at the cloud storage manager, the storage metadata to generate usage information;
storing, via the cloud storage manager, the storage metadata at a cloud metadata storage system located at the geographical location of the cloud storage manager, without storing the actual data backed up during the backup operation at the cloud metadata storage system; and
providing graphical user interface (GUI) features at the local storage manager, the GUI features indicative of whether the local storage manager is operating in a local mode in which the local storage manager can control data storage and recover operations, and a remote mode in which the local storage manager is able to view, but not control, data storage and recovery operations.
4 Assignments
0 Petitions
Accused Products
Abstract
A Remote Metadata Center provides Distaster Recovery (DR) testing and metadata backup services to multiple business organizations. Metadata associated with local data backups performed at business organizations is transmitted to the Remote Metadata Center. Corresponding backup data is stored in a data storage system that is either stored locally at the business organization or at a data storage facility that is at a different location than the Remote Metadata Center and the business organization. DR testing can be staged from the Remote Data Center using the metadata received and optionally with assistance from an operator at the business organization and/or the data storage facility.
-
Citations
20 Claims
-
1. A computer program product comprising a non-transitory computer-readable media having code stored thereon, the code when executed by a processor, causing the processor to assist in providing a cloud-based backup storage service to a computer network at a cloud-based backup storage facility, the method comprising:
-
configuring, at the cloud-based backup storage facility, a cloud storage manager to communicatively couple to a local storage manager, wherein the cloud storage manager is at a geographical location that is remote from a geographical location of the local storage manager, wherein the computer network includes the local storage manager but not the cloud storage manager; wherein the local storage manager is configured to control a backup operation of data in the computer network and communicate storage metadata generated during the backup operation to the cloud storage manager, wherein the storage metadata includes metadata pointers, lookup tables, or any combination thereof, wherein the storage metadata is used during restoration of actual data backed up during the backup operation into usable data, and wherein the storage metadata is generated during the backup operation of data in the computer network; receiving, without receiving the actual data backed up during the backup operation, the storage metadata at the cloud storage manager; processing, at the cloud storage manager, the storage metadata to generate usage information; storing, via the cloud storage manager, the storage metadata at a cloud metadata storage system located at the geographical location of the cloud storage manager, without storing the actual data backed up during the backup operation at the cloud metadata storage system; and providing graphical user interface (GUI) features at the local storage manager, the GUI features indicative of whether the local storage manager is operating in a local mode in which the local storage manager can control data storage and recover operations, and a remote mode in which the local storage manager is able to view, but not control, data storage and recovery operations.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. A method for providing a cloud-based backup storage service to a computer network at a cloud-based backup storage facility, the method comprising:
-
configuring, at the cloud-based backup storage facility, a cloud storage manager to communicatively couple to a local storage manager, wherein the cloud storage manager is at a geographical location that is remote from a geographical location of the local storage manager, wherein the computer network includes the local storage manager but not the cloud storage manager; wherein the local storage manager is configured to control a backup operation of data in the computer network and communicate storage metadata generated during the backup operation to the cloud storage manager, wherein the storage metadata includes metadata pointers, lookup tables, or any combination thereof, wherein the storage metadata is used during restoration of actual data backed up during the backup operation into usable data, and wherein the storage metadata is generated during the backup operation of data in the computer network; receiving, without receiving the actual data backed up during the backup operation, the storage metadata at the cloud storage manager; processing, at the cloud storage manager, the storage metadata to generate usage information; storing, via the cloud storage manager, the storage metadata at a cloud metadata storage system located at the geographical location of the cloud storage manager, without storing the actual data backed up during the backup operation at the cloud metadata storage system; and providing graphical user interface (GUI) features at the local storage manager, the GUI features indicative of whether the local storage manager is operating in a local mode in which the local storage manager can control data storage and recover operations, and a remote mode in which the local storage manager is able to view, but not control, data storage and recovery operations. - View Dependent Claims (12, 13, 14, 15)
-
-
16. A system for providing a cloud-based backup storage service to a computer network at a cloud-based backup storage facility, the system comprising:
-
at least one hardware processor; at least one non-transitory memory, coupled to the at least one hardware processor and storing instructions, which when executed by the at least one hardware processor, perform a method, the method comprising; configuring, at the cloud-based backup storage facility, a cloud storage manager to communicatively couple to a local storage manager, wherein the cloud storage manager is at a geographical location that is remote from a geographical location of the local storage manager, wherein the computer network includes the local storage manager but not the cloud storage manager; wherein the local storage manager is configured to control a backup operation of data in the computer network and communicate storage metadata generated during the backup operation to the cloud storage manager, wherein the storage metadata includes metadata pointers, lookup tables, or any combination thereof, wherein the storage metadata is used during restoration of actual data backed up during the backup operation into usable data, and wherein the storage metadata is generated during the backup operation of data in the computer network; receiving, without receiving the actual data backed up during the backup operation, the storage metadata at the cloud storage manager; processing, at the cloud storage manager, the storage metadata to generate usage information; storing, via the cloud storage manager, the storage metadata at a cloud metadata storage system located at the geographical location of the cloud storage manager, without storing the actual data backed up during the backup operation at the cloud metadata storage system; and providing graphical user interface (GUI) features at the local storage manager, the GUI features indicative of whether the local storage manager is operating in a local mode in which the local storage manager can control data storage and recover operations, and a remote mode in which the local storage manager is able to view, but not control, data storage and recovery operations. - View Dependent Claims (17, 18, 19, 20)
-
Specification